Thelonious Monk was an eccentric genius and considered to be one of the greatest composers in jazz history.

Answers

Thelonious Monk was an American jazz pianist and composer who is considered one of the greatest composers in jazz history. He was an eccentric genius who revolutionized the jazz genre with his unique style, which was characterized by angular melodies, complex harmonies, and unusual rhythms.

He was also known for his idiosyncratic playing style, which featured percussive attacks, unexpected pauses, and dissonant chords.Monk was born in Rocky Mount, North Carolina, in 1917, but his family moved to New York City when he was young.

He began playing piano at the age of six and was largely self-taught. By the time he was a teenager, he was playing in local clubs and had developed a reputation as a talented musician.Monk's music was influenced by a wide variety of sources, including the blues, swing, bebop, and classical music. He was known for his ability to create complex compositions that challenged both the performers and the listeners.

His most famous compositions include "Round Midnight," "Straight, No Chaser," and "Blue Monk."Monk's music was not widely appreciated during his lifetime, and he struggled to gain recognition and financial success. However, his influence on the jazz genre was profound, and his compositions continue to be performed and admired by musicians and jazz enthusiasts around the world. Monk died in 1982 at the age of 64, but his legacy as a composer and pianist continues to live on.
